Carter’s passion for Bonaventure and basketball led to successful pro career

November 30, 2020 by Chuckie Maggio 2 Comments

By CHUCKIE MAGGIO There was little reason for George Carter to suit up against a Division III team with a broken toe on Dec. 17, 1964. Carter, a sophomore who led St. Bonaventure in scoring and rebounding, suffered a chip fracture in the big toe of his left foot against St. Francis Pa. four days prior and wasn’t expected to play against Illinois Wesleyan.
